[RC] Mt. Carmel XP Ride Photos - Dream Weaver

http://aerc.org/Photo_Gallery/MTCARMEL2008/MTCARMELXP2008.HTML  The ride was very nice this year - great weather, and a good turnout.  Some new trail which allowed less repeat and made for a really enjoyable three days of riding in colorful southern Utah!  If you haven't ever done this ride, check out the photos and look at the terrific scenery.  There is so much variety with just enough technical trail to keep it challenging and interesting. 

I had a really nice ride this year on all three days.  Rode Chief on days 1 and 3, riding with Kevin Myers and a few other riders or alone, you'll see everyone in the photos.  On the middle day I was fortunate enough to be able to try out a new horse, that I absolutely fell in love with!  The bay colored ears are Bo's, in the photos.  I had only started looking about a week before Mt. Carmel so was very fortunate to have found such a nice well trained, well started horse all ready to go - so quickly.  Liked him enough that I brought him home and am looking forward to riding him at Fort Schellbourne.  :)
